Pugh, OSM <br />This complete inspection was conducted on November 29, 1994. <br />The weather was clear and cold. During the past summer the <br />contour ditches had been reworked and the rills and gullies <br />regraded. According to the State Inspector these redisturbed <br />areas had been reseeded but there was no evidence of <br />germination at the time of the inspection. These areas had <br />not been mulched; however, the portion of the regraded Ditch <br />#3 downdrain that lay outside of the new rip-rap had been <br />mulched. <br />The sediment ponds appeared to be stable and some contained a <br />small amount of water. The entrance channel to Pond #2 showed <br />some slight erosion, additional rip-rap would prevent this <br />from developing into a problem. Sediment had been removed <br />from Pond #5 and place outside of drainage control.
